Marlies End Losing Streak with 3-2 Win over Peoria Rivermen
Greg Scott and Ben Gordon’s Two-Point Nights Propel Marlies to Victory

(TORONTO) – The Marlies ended the 2009 calendar year with a 3-2 victory over the Peoria Rivermen on Wednesday night. Joey MacDonald snapped a seven-game losing streak in the win and was named the game’s third star.

After shutting out the Rivermen through two periods, MacDonald allowed a pair of goals late in the third period, but then made key saves in the final minutes of the game for Toronto.

“MacDonald had a big game for us tonight and made some massive saves to keep us in the game,” head coach Dallas Eakins said after the game. “He deserves a lot of the credit in the win we got tonight.”

MacDonald’s last win came on October 30 against Adirondack.

Greg Scott opened the scoring early in the first period on a power play goal. Ben Gordon had the puck behind Peoria’s net and fed a pass to Scott who beat Rivermen starting goalie Hannu Toivonen glove-side. Ashton Rome, who signed with the Marlies earlier in the day, registered an assist on Scott’s second goal of the season.

Ben Gordon netted his second goal of the season with a wrist shot that went top shelf on Toivonen’s glove-side. Boyce carried the puck down the ice from the Marlies zone and passed it to Gordon who was streaking down the wing. scoring the game's second goal.

Juraj Mikus made it a 3-0 game in the second period with a phantom goal from the red-line. Mikus dumped the puck into Peoria’s zone on a power play and it hit the partition with Toivonen out of position and it bounced into the empty net.

The Rivermen scored two late goals but the Marlies held on and improved their record to 8-0-2 when taking a lead into the third period.

The Marlies open the 2010 year with a home game on Saturday afternoon against the Milwaukee Admirals at 4:00 p.m. at Ricoh Coliseum.
